Mia Tindale Guesstures - signs of silent expression
Communication extends beyond the spoken word. Our bodies speak the truth that our mouths forbid. We can express our innermost contemplations through a simple gesture. The way we move, fidget, relax, touch and reach provide a greater voice than we give to our words. But clenched fists or clasped hands are not linked exclusively to one meaning. Our body language creates boundless communication, with hand movements acting as key markers of private sentiment.
